Deadline looms for Fingal Film Festival

Local filmmakers are being reminded they have until Monday, 30th June to make their submissions for the third Fingal Film Festival. This year, eight awards will be up for grabs which will be presented on the final night of the festival at an awards ceremony on 28th September 2014.
As the submission deadline approaches, the Fingal Film Festival team are overwhelmed with the response of filmmakers in this, the third year of the festival.
June 30th is the final day of the submissions and the festival organisers and staff want to extend their congratulations to all the filmmakers who have submitted material to date.
So far submissions have tripled from last year with films comprising of documentaries, feature films, animations, short films and Irish language films, and student films.
Meath filmmakers Ronan O’Sullivan and Robbie Smyth have both submitted films to the festival this year.
“It has been an unprecedented year for submissions” says Liz Kenny, “and the introduction of our Irish language section, has seen us inundated with Irish language films”.
Prizes range from cash to film equipment to broadcasting of films.
